Schneider Electric is hiring a
Senior Business Analyst – Warehouse/Logistics
to support our Titan Transformation Program, deploying SAP across North American plants. In this role, you will lead the transition from legacy systems to SAP, ensuring warehouse management processes are optimized for end-to-end operations. You will collaborate with stakeholders, gather requirements, analyze data, and drive change management initiatives. Join us and play a key role in Schneider Electric’s digital transformation.
This position requires 30%-50% travel across the U.S., Canada, and Mexico.
What will you do?
Identify warehouse management business requirements and develop the SAP customer story backlog.
Act as a Change Agent, supporting the Product Owner in resolving issues between legacy and future state systems.
Manage knowledge transfer to key users, data owners, and local management teams.
Capture user feedback and identify enhancements for existing functionality.
Facilitate stakeholder workshops and validate end-to-end process flows for manufacturing plants.
Contribute to localization of project documentation (training materials, test scripts, and related content).
Ensure site readiness through planning, support, audits, and training.
Represent the business in program discussions with deep knowledge of current warehouse management processes and systems.
Site Responsibilities
Drive business transformation, solution decisions, data accuracy, and organizational change management.
Participate in end‑user training and hold key users and data owners accountable for deliverables.
Lead key user and project team participation in solution testing.
Working Conditions
Ability to manage tight deadlines and multiple priorities in a fast‑paced environment.
Flexibility to work outside standard hours across time zones, including early mornings, evenings, and weekends as needed.
What qualifications will make you successful for this role?
Bachelor’s degree in Supply Chain, Business Administration or related field is required.
3-5 years of experience in logistics or warehousing.
Knowledge of internal plant warehouse operations (including put‑away, replenishment, and internal logistics processes).
Experience with SAP Warehouse Management and Extended Warehouse Management modules.
Familiarity with Engineer‑to‑Order (ETO), Configure‑to‑Order (CTO), and Make‑to‑Order (MTO) flows.
Strong data analysis, change management, and communication skills.
Proven track record of delivering results.
Leadership and stakeholder management capabilities.
Ability to manage multiple priorities effectively.
